Augmented RealityAugmented Reality is simply creating digital media for hardcopy objects using a software on yourcomputer, smartphone or tablet.

The software’s job is to scan the hardcopy image called (trigger image) with the phone camera anddisplay the digital information (overlay media) on screen.

Examples of Augmented Reality of software are: Aurasma, Blippar, Layar, Wikitude, XARMEX, Zapparetc.

Trigger image (hardcopy) Overlay (digital media)

Trigger Images should be sharpand clear.

Overlay are digital media (videos, audio, 3D animations eBooks, photos etc)

Not too dark. Bright photos. Overlay can be in any form as softcopy.

They are hardcopies or mostly printed images.

The are softcopies and are within the tablet, Smartphone or computer.

Using Aurasma software with internet connection:1. Download Aurasma app on your Android (Playstore) or iOS (app store)

phone or tablet.2. Create an Aurasma Account. With a cool username.3. Get a (hardcopy) photo as a trigger image. E.g Your birthday photo.4. Aurasma will request you to create an overlay photo or video e.g Record a

10 secs video of your birthday party. 5. Aurasma will ask for a trigger image e.g your birthday photo.6. If you save it as private project no one can assess it online. But as public

project everyone can assess it, by Finding and Liking your username on Aurasma.

7. Remember Aurasma works with internet connection. That is how your friends and family can assess projects.

Finally

• Anytime you launch the Aurasma app on your smartphone

or tablet and hover it over the trigger image you created;

the overlay object appears on your screen.

• When you make your project PUBLIC,

photocopy the trigger image and share with your friends and family

`who can download the Aurasma app.

• Give them the NAME of your Aurasma project.

They will search it with the Aurasma app and FOLLOW your channel for the overlay to overlay to be triggered by the image you

photocopied/printed.
